When a would-be North Carolina pastor, called 911 he explained that he had taken a strong cough medicine before falling asleep only to wake up to find his wife stabbed to death. While Matthew Phelps may hope the cough syrup defense might save him from a murder conviction, police say the 26-year-old was obsessed with "American Psycho," a movie about a serial killer.
